WebPorthill Bridge, also often referred to as Port Hill Footbridge, is a suspension bridge for pedestrians crossing the River Severn in Shrewsbury, Shropshire, England. Porthill Bridge … WebJun 18, 2024 · The Porthill Bridge connects Porthill with The Quarry and the town centre and provides easy access to the Boathouse pub. The 10ft wide suspension bridge also experiences significant vibration, even when only a few people are crossing it, which is quite an experience when you're leaving the pub!

Kingsland Bridge is a privately owned toll bridge, spanning the River Severn in Shrewsbury, Shropshire. It is located near Shrewsbury School and the cost for cars to cross is 20p. It is a Grade II listed building. Based on: Wikipedia. Completed: 1883 (140 years ago) Coordinates: 52°42'15"N, 2°45'32"W.
